The Placer Breast Cancer Foundation is a volunteer-based organization dedicated to fighting breast cancer through research, education, and outreach programs within the Placer and Sacramento County areas. Originally established as the Placer Breast Cancer Endowment in 2005 with the goal of raising $1.5 million for a Breast Cancer Chair at UC Davis, the foundation has since expanded its mission. They fund research, including studies on Triple Negative breast cancer and BRCA2 protein, and support initiatives like the Mammo+ Bus for underserved communities. The foundation also prioritizes education and support through programs like the Placer Women's Retreat and Students for A Cure, and collaborates with other local nonprofits to assist patients, survivors, and caregivers. All funds raised stay within the local community.
